This year, more details were released about Pop Smoke’s killing, including how detectives tracked his alleged killers. In July 2020, two adults and two teenagers were charged with murder over his death. Born Bashar Barakah Jackson, Pop Smoke “gave a generation of New York rap fans a new wind at their back and did so in just a few months,” August Brown wrote. The rapper was one of the most promising voices from the New York drill scene, a regional variant of a hard-edged, gothic sound, The Times has reported. In February 2020, a group broke into a Hollywood Hills home and took the life of Pop Smoke.
